How to Write 尧 (yáo) — Meaning “Yao (legendary monarch); high”

yáo 6 strokes Radical: 兀

尧 (yáo) means "Yao (legendary monarch); high" in Chinese. It has 6 strokes with the radical 兀.

尧 originally depicted a person with a tall headdress, symbolizing high status or physical height. The radical 兀 emphasizes the idea of something protruding or elevated, connecting to the meaning 'high' and the legendary emperor Yao's lofty virtue.
